Language Repository of Switzerland awarded joint CLARIN B-Centre certification

CLARIN B-Centre certification

LaRS@SWISSUbase (Language Repository of Switzerland) and LiRI (Linguistic Research Infrastructure) have been officially awarded the joint CLARIN B-Centre certification.Together, they form a distributed centre: LiRI serves as the technical hub providing specialized expertise, while LaRS@SWISSUbase manages the dedicated repository required by CLARIN. This internationally recognized status confirms that LaRS@SWISSUbase – the Swiss repository for language data – meets the highest standards for data preservation, technical robustness, and FAIR-compliance. 

LaRS@SWISSUbase is curated and hosted by the University Library Zurich and is the national platform for the publication of linguistic research data. To be recognized as and receive B-Centre certification, LaRS has to comply with the requirements set out by CLARIN. These include, for instance, CoreTrustSeal certification for the repository, adherence to harvestable metadata standards, quality of service, formats, protocols and APIs as well as providing persistent identifiers.

The B-Centre certification is the result of a highly successful collaboration of many parties. It ensures that researchers in Switzerland can confidently deposit linguistic data, while researchers across Europe and beyond can discover and reuse it in a sustainable and standardized environment.
